HSFModem can't compile modules
Гость 28 июля, 2006 - 19:02
Привет всем. Вот случилось мне перейти на gentoo, о чём ничуть не жалею ;-) Раньше был на других дистрибутивах linux.
Но везде вечной проблемой был мой вин-модем. Хотя я нашел для него дрова - hsfmodem7. Компилируется драйвер этот хорошо - простой командой make. А вот когда дело доходит до подгонки драйвера под данный модем - то конец. Значит даю я ему место расположения исходных кодов ядра - он начинает делать нужные модули для модема и тут пишет building modules failed. Смотрю лог сборки ошибка в следушем - в файле osusb.c - недекларированная функция URB_ASYNC_UNLINK. Что это значит. Похоже еще на параметр в конфиге ядра, хотя искал - это там нет. Помогите, ведь дрова эти на mandriva шли, а чем gentoo хуже :)
»
- Для комментирования войдите или зарегистрируйтесь
Я бы
Я бы посоветовал тебе перейти на обычный модем.Тем более теперь в эру глобального перехода на adsl и оптику,взять такой модем у кого-нибудь не составит труда.
А по сути вопроса попробуй найти эти дрова в портежах emerge -s hsfmodem.Вроде они там есть
Re: Я бы
Да, может модем найти не трудно, но где в эру глобального перехода на adsl и оптику взять на всё это добро денег простому девятикласснику? :) А в portage я действительно не посмотрел. Посмотрю скоро (щас компа нет рядом). Но тут небольшая загвоздка тоже есть - дрова надо патяить для поддержки полной скорости модема.
Драйвер там
Драйвер там точно есть. И кое-кто из моих знакомых его даже использует вот уже полгода:)
непонял
ты емерж делал или руками?
я руками делал
я руками делал
а попробуй
а попробуй через
если это можно сделать нормальным путём, зачем руками делать?
Я только что
Я только что пытался ставить себе hsfmodem -- модули действительно не скомпилились.
Проблема решилась установкой ACCEPT_KEYWORDS="~x86" emerge hsfmodem
Пробовал соедениться, всё работает на ура! Ужасно доволен, что удалось модем завести на ноуте, так как не всегда есть доступ к сети.
OK
Ну слава Богу! Решилась проблема просто - на форуме драйвера был уже такой вопрос. Просто версия драйвера что у меня была (7.18.00.05) использовала параметр ядра URB_USYNC_UNLINK, который был убран из ядер 2.6.14 и выше. А у меня 2.6.15. Так что я просто скачал последнюю версию драйвера -и вуаля - всё работает. Теперь новая трабла - pppd выдает ошибку 19, то есть ошибка авторизации, хотя 100% правильно прописаны в /etc/wvdial.conf пароль и имя пользователя. Вроде такое было уже, так ято разберусь. Спасибо всем за поддрежку...
hsfmodem --license
А пропатчить конект с 14kb --> 56kb тоесть грёбаную лицензию получилось ???
Могу дать
Могу дать лекарство, пиши в jabber.